Here’s the preliminary schedule for the Orlando Air Show
Opening Ceremonies
Invocation
National Anthem
REMAX Jump Team
Michael Goulian aeroabtic preview
U.S. Coast Guard Search and Rescue Demo
Buck Roetman
B-25 Mitchell "Panchito"
F-22 Raptor Demo
Air Force Heritage Flight
Quicksilver P-51 Mustang Demo
Michael Goulian
Navy Blue Angels
